STYLISE

stylize, stylise, conventionalize

(verb) represent according to a conventional style; “a stylized female head”

Source: WordNet® 3.1


Etymology

Verb

stylise (third-person singular simple present stylises, present participle stylising, simple past and past participle stylised)

Non-Oxford British standard spelling of stylize.

Source: Wiktionary

Coffee Trivia

There are four varieties of commercially viable coffee: Arabica, Liberica, Excelsa, and Robusta. Growers predominantly plant the Arabica species. Although less popular, Robusta tastes slightly more bitter and contains more caffeine.
